Research In Situ Exploitation Method And Well Pattern Optimization Of Oil Shale In Block A Of Jilin Oilfield

The Block A of Jilin Oilfield is located in Songliao Basin of China,which contains rich oil shale and has high development potential.The oil shale in Block A is deep and discontinuous,the single layer of oil shale is thin,and there is a thick mudstone interlayer developed.It is not applicable to surface methods.Therefore,it is necessary to optimize the appropriate in-situ mining method and the well pattern.This paper takes the oil shale in Block A of Jilin Oilfield as the research object and draws the following conclusions through laboratory experiments and numerical simulation methods.(1)The law of porosity and permeability changing with temperature after pyrolysis of oil shale is studied by using CT and empirical formula.The results show that the pyrolysis stage of kerogen of oil shale in Block A is mainly in the range of 250℃~550℃,and the porosity and permeability of oil shale increase greatly.(2)The most mature in-situ mining method is electric heating,which has the disadvantages of small heating radius.So,the thermal fluid assisted electric heating was designed and studied by numerical simulation.Without artificial fracturing,the injected hot fluid only stays in the wellbore and near the wellbore area,unable to play the role of convective heating of fluid.Therefore,artificial fracturing is needed.(3)Under artificial fracturing,the fractures with different cluster intervals are designed.The heating effect and reservoir physical properties of different methods are studied.The results show that the optimal fracture cluster interval is 5m,and the optimal heating method is thermal CO2assisted electric heating.(4)The Horizontal well pattern is designed,which is triangular,rectangular,square,and row pattern.The heating effect and heat loss of different well patterns are studied,and the results show that the row well pattern is the best well pattern(5)The key parameters were optimized by using numerical simulation,including heating cable temperature and power,CO2 gas temperature,injection rate,and well pattern rotation strategy.Finally,the pilot test scheme was designed.
